Project Clinics
Live working sessions for your real projects
Project Clinics are live working sessions included with your membership, focused on your actual SketchUp, LayOut, or Enscape files. You can bring a project to the call or send a file ahead of time. We’ll review your model together, make targeted fixes, and outline a clear next step you can take after the session.
Clinics run twice per month, so you always have a regular place to get hands-on help on active work.
Community Hub
Support as you learn and implement
The Community Hub is your space to ask questions, share progress, and get support as you move through the courses and your day-to-day projects. You can post screenshots or models, follow up after a Project Clinic, or get a second opinion on a workflow you’re testing. It’s there to keep you moving between live sessions.

Sketchup Trainer Membership FAQ's
Who is the SketchUp Trainer Membership for?
The membership is designed for working design professionals and serious learners who use SketchUp on real projects. That includes interior designers, architects, landscape designers, contractors, educators, and advanced hobbyists who want production-grade workflows.
Is this membership right for me if I’m brand new to SketchUp?
Yes. The course library includes a clear Getting Started path, so you can begin with the basics and build up to more advanced workflows over time. You’ll also have access to Project Clinics and
Can I upgrade from Monthly Membership to an Annual Membership?
Yes. You can upgrade at any time. Your new yearly plan will start when you switch, so you can keep learning without interruption.
What if I can’t attend Project Clinics live?
Live attendance is encouraged when you can make it, but it’s not required. Replays are available to members, so you can watch later, review solutions, and apply them on your own schedule.
Do I get access to future courses?
Yes. With an active monthly or yearly membership, you’ll get access to every new course and all future updates at no additional cost.
Can I share my membership with my team?
Memberships are intended for individual use and login sharing isn’t supported. If you’d like access or training for multiple people on your team, reach out and we can talk about firm-wide options or private group training.

How are Project Clinics different from private training?
Project Clinics are small-group working sessions included with your membership, where I help members live using real files and questions. Private training is 1:1, fully tailored to you or your team, and goes deeper into your specific projects and standards. Many members use the membership for ongoing learning and Project Clinics, and book private training when they need more intensive support.
What software do I need?
For the best experience, you’ll want SketchUp Pro (desktop), a stable internet connection, and ideally a 3-button scroll-wheel mouse. Some lessons and workflows also use LayOut and Enscape; when those are required, it will be clearly noted in the course description.
